About Anicetus

Anicetus, a Greek name, emanates from the term "A-níketos (ἀ-νίκητος) / Aníketos (Ανίκητος)," meaning "unconquerable." This name is rooted in the Ancient Greek word "νῑκάω (nīkáō)," signifying "to prevail, be superior, to conquer, vanquish, beat." Its etymology can be traced back to "νίκη (níkē)," which translates to "victory."

In Greek mythology, Aniceto was the moniker bestowed upon one of the sons of Heracles and Hebe. Furthermore, Pope Anicetus, who presided over the See of Rome from approximately 157 to 168, was known by this name. Historical records, such as the "Liber Pontificalis," indicate that Anicetus was a Syrian from the city of Emesa (present-day Homs).
